【发布时间】:2021-12-18 10:52:24
【问题描述】:
假设我有一个包含多个表和外键等的数据库。我正在尝试找到能够在不使用顶层 SQL 的情况下查询数据库的解决方案。换句话说,我想要一种让非技术人员能够从 UI 查询 SQL 数据库的直观方式。
我可以提供一个预定义的可能查询列表,例如“X 的薪水是多少?”每个未知数的下拉值。我也看过自然语言翻译,但似乎找不到任何支持多个表的好方法。
有人有什么建议吗?我只是想调查一些想法。
【问题讨论】:
-
您非常接近发明 BI/报告系统。请查看 PowerBI、Tableau、QlikView/QlikSense、Cognos 和类似系统
-
如果您想要自然语言查询,请查看 Thoughtspot
标签: sql database linq nlp translation